Yeah when I installed the power fc it solved the issue. After I looked at the readings it would sometimes say my intake temps were 100c (boiling air?). I think the stock ecu relies on the IAT sensor signal more than the power fc causing the spark cut. At first I saw no sign that the intake temp sensor was not working. But after a week or so a check light would flash every once in a while. I would pull your codes and see if that code 14 has ever shown up.
